Word on the street, or in the Tuileries, is that French Vogue was blacklisted from Balenciaga via Max Mara.
The magazines editor-in-chief, Carine Roitfeld, consults, or did consult, for the Italian brand. She allegedly asked Balenciaga for samples for an editorial shoot, and one of the coats ended up at Max Maras design studio where it was copied and then sent back to Paris.
Balenciagas notoriously strict with their samples almost everyone has to promise theyll shoot the head to toe runway look and samples are usually lent out for a day at a time and when the French label heard about Max Mara, they lost it.
If fashion were a monarchy, Carine would be our queen, so we hate to think she deliberately sent Max Mara the coat, but our sources say it was no mistake.
